Common name: | BUG11,OFD1 |
Defline: | Oral-facial-digital syndrome basal body protein 1; (1 of 1) PTHR15431:SF5 - ORAL-FACIAL-DIGITAL SYNDROME 1 PROTEIN |
Description: | Homolog of Oral-facial-digital syndrome protein 1; Found in one basal body proteome as BUG11 [PMID: 15964273]; Found in another basal body proteome as OFD1 [PMID: 28781053]; Transcript upregulated during flagellar regeneration [PMID: 15738400]; Mammalian homolog is required for ciliogenesis and structure of distal fibers of centriole |
Synonyms: | Cre17.g703600.t1.1,BUG11,g17058.t2,OFD1 |
Chromosome: | chromosome 17 |
